General worker x3 – Free State – Temporary position paid at a rate of R90 per hour
Our client has the following 3 month temporary vacancy available.
Key Performance Areas:
-
- Remove plants in the preparation of new/old beds, prepare the soil using the correct procedure and level to the agreed standard and landscape plan.
- Plant plants according to the planning plan, according to the standard and procedure for planting within agreed time frame.
- Water plants/ lawn according to agreed water region for each species and schedules.
- Load or removal of soil/compost /dead or new plants according to the correct procedure within agreed time frame.
- Fertilise, top dress, weed, feed lawns, mulch and feed beds according to the correct procedure, and schedules within agreed time frame.
- Prune clip, stake and train plants in accordance to horticultural best practices.
- Keep edges of flower beds according to the standards set for the garden.
- Assist in keeping pathways, water courses and drain clean/ clear of obstruction at all times.
- Report on pest and diseases.
- Raking of leaves on the lawns.
- Washing of tools after every use.
- Assist in litter management in and outside zoo parameters.
- Developments of new gardens inside the animal enclosures.
- Blowing of leaves using a blower
- Planting of trees around the zoo.
- Participation during environmental education programs.
- Removal of alien invasive in the zoo.
- Loading and uploading of plants.
- Identify and manual remove the unwanted plants/weeds/alien in beds or the estate using the correct removal techniques/ with agreed time.
- Act in complete compliance with the code of conduct, JCPZ policies and regulations.
- Apply the principles of managing diversity.
- Landscaping of gardens
- Identify and manually remove the unwanted plants/weeds/aliens in the beds
- Maintain all plants under your care according to correct procedures and propagation plan.
- Do not remove any plants without consulting the propagation plan for each use.
- Ensure that the correct plant labels stay with correct plantings and ensure it is correctly positioned.
- Be friendly and professional when dealing/assisting the public, and all other customers
- Share information accurately and openly
- Assist with plant displays and exhibitions.
- Identify possible risks to visitors and report immediately to any of the supervisors
- Identify waste and report immediately to any of supervisors
- Identify feral animals and report immediately to any of supervisors
Knowledge and Skills
-
- Basic knowledge of indigenous plants/ trees, weeds and alien plants/trees
- Knowledge of garden tools and how to use them
- Safety rules and regulations
- Organisational Policies and Procedures
- Deliverables according to daily job cards
- User/ instruction manuals of equipment and tools
- Problem solving (Basic)
- Communication Skills (Basic)
- Interpersonal Skills (Basic)
- Teamwork (Intermediate)
- Conflict management (Intermediate)
- Ability to work hard in different weather conditions
- Physical strength and fitness (Excellent)
- Ability and competence to operate different manual tools and equipment safely
